TheNode Cum Amplifier Optical Receiveris built with the integration ofnodeandamplifierfunctionalities in a single, compact unit. Thenodeis responsible for receiving, processing, and routing the optical signals, while theamplifierensures that the signal is boosted without degradation. This integration allows for seamless operation and efficient signal processing, reducing the need for multiple devices and minimizing space requirements.
Thisdual-functionalitysimplifies system design and installation, allowing network engineers to deployoptical networkswith ease. By combining both components into one device, the optical receiver reduces the complexity of setups while improving system reliability.
One of the most significant advantages of theNode Cum Amplifier Optical Receiveris its ability to amplify optical signals over long distances. Infiber-optic communications, signal attenuation occurs as the light travels through fiber, leading to signal degradation. Theamplificationfunction of thenodeeffectively counters this problem by boosting the strength of the signal before it reaches the receiver.
Theoptical receiveris engineered to amplify signals without introducing significant noise or distortion, maintaining high signal integrity. This makes it suitable for large-scaletelecommunications networks,broadcasting systems, anddata transmission infrastructures, where long-distance signal transmission is critical.

Noise is a major concern in optical communication systems, as it can lead to signal degradation and reduced data throughput. TheNode Cum Amplifier Optical Receiveris designed withlow-noise amplification, ensuring that the signal is amplified without introducing significant unwanted noise. This feature is essential in ensuring that the received signal is clean and maintains high fidelity.
Additionally, thehigh sensitivityof the optical receiver ensures that even weak signals can be detected and processed effectively. This makes thenode cum amplifierideal forlong-range transmissionorlow-power applications, where signals may be faint but still need to be received accurately and amplified to usable levels.
